BASKETBALL 5×5 – U16 – JCBA boys and girls reach the quarter-finals

The competition has entered its knockout phase with the round of 16 of the U16 national championship for girls and boys in Ambositra. The highlight of the day is the qualification of the Jeunes Chrétiens Basketteurs d’Antananarivo (JCBA).

The round of 16 showed that clubs from Analamanga are shining in Ambositra. Five girls’ teams and three boys’ teams have secured their tickets to the quarter-finals, confirming the strong state of basketball in the capital.

In the girls’ category, Analamanga’s dominance is particularly clear. ASSM, JCBA, Fandrefiala, Lucadro, and NAS have all passed the round of 16. ASSM defeated SEPA ABM (48-35), while JCBA overcame TSBB (51-32). Fandrefiala left no chance for USF (95-18), while Lucadro dominated ASBM (69-42). Meanwhile, NAS beat CRJS (60-42).

Other teams also joined the eight quarter-finalists. Phoenix and FFRP-BCTM, both from Vakinankaratra, validated their qualification, as did the winner of the duel between Ascut Atsinanana and Pintade d’Amoron’i Mania, which was still ongoing at the time of going to press.

In the boys’ category, Analamanga currently has three representatives in the quarter-finals: JCBA, ASSM, and NAS. JCBA eliminated A2BC (56-47), ASSM dominated NBE (65-41), while NAS narrowly defeated Fandrefiala (53-50).

However, competition from other regions remains strong. Fivam from Alaotra-Mangoro, Ascut from Atsinanana, SBC from Vakinankaratra, and JSB from Boeny have also secured their qualification. The final spot for the quarter-finals remains to be decided between AS Monfort from Amoron’i Mania and MB2ALL from Analamanga, whose match was still in progress.
